Transaction 078868006fe1a7c2e5861fe27cdd95ae56add5ca5e2c86013c6bbef33b645c87
3 Input
2 Outputs
- 078868006fe1a7c2e5861fe27cdd95ae56add5ca5e2c86013c6bbef33b645c87:0
- 078868006fe1a7c2e5861fe27cdd95ae56add5ca5e2c86013c6bbef33b645c87:1
value 19760000
address 1KfW4JfPAWFfW8oZmTv4BQZC5pFfAZ9GNp
value 59199989
address 17pLK65Czjz5fUDd4mWCPft2QYmTxossLa